Job Summary


The RAPID Humanitarian Operations Technical Advisor I provides deployable, technical and operational support to CRS humanitarian emergency responses under the guidance of HRD staff. The role contributes to CRS' capacity, supporting target countries across a specified focus region, of emergency operations across core humanitarian functions, with primary emphasis on supply chain management—particularly procurement and logistics—and emergency suboffice setup.
The Humanitarian Operations Technical Advisor I works closely with colleagues and other technical departments to support the establishment and strengthening operational functions, including human resources, finance, security, ICT, administration, and fleet management. S/he supports the application of CRS operational standards and donor requirements, contributes to operational learning and guidance implementation, and assists with capacity strengthening efforts for CRS country programs and partners to promote efficient, compliant, and effective humanitarian response operations.


Roles & Responsibilities

General


Provide rapid deployment, in-country operational surge support during humanitarian emergencies, applying operational experience to support procurement, logistics, supply chain processes, and emergency suboffice setup.
Support emergency operations planning, implementation, and close out through remote and onsite technical assistance, aligned with CRS standards, donor requirements, and good humanitarian practice.
Assist with the setup and functioning of relief delivery systems, tools, and operational processes in active emergency contexts.

Provide operational support across HR, finance, security, GKIM, administration, and fleet management, in coordination with relevant CRS technical and departmental leads.



Capacity Strengthening and Accompaniment


Provide on the job support and basic technical accompaniment to CRS staff and local partners during emergency responses.
Support delivery of operations focused trainings, briefings, and orientations for emergency staff and partners.
Contribute to collaboration with local organizations and national and international CRS teams to strengthen operational capacity for emergency response.


Technical Standards, Learning, and Compliance


Support the application of humanitarian operations standards, tools, and guidance for field operations and emergency supply chains.
Contribute to updates and dissemination of tools and resources related to the Emergency Field Operations Manual (EFOM).
Support operational learning by helping document lessons learned, challenges, and good practices from emergency deployments.
Assist with emergency budgeting, basic cost tracking and support compliance with public donor regulations and operational requirements.
Management of supply chain and accounting systems in new or rapidly evolving emergency responses.
Promote awareness of staff care, safety, and security practices in emergency environments.


Coordination and Representation Support


Support CRS participation in humanitarian coordination, cluster, and operations forums, as requested and under guidance.
